const getAuthTokens = async (userId, providerLabel) => {
return requestTokensFromProvider(userId, providerLabel, {
checkAccessToken: true,
returnAccessToken: true,
})
}
const requestTokensFromProvider = async (
userId,
providerLabel,
options = {},
) => {
const { checkAccessToken, returnAccessToken } = options
const providerUserIdentity = await Identity.findOne({
userId,
provider: providerLabel,
})
if (!providerUserIdentity) {
throw new Error(`identity for provider ${providerLabel} does not exist`)
}
const {
oauthAccessToken,
oauthAccessTokenExpiration,
oauthRefreshToken,
oauthRefreshTokenExpiration,
} = providerUserIdentity
const UTCNowTimestamp = moment().utc().toDate().getTime()
if (checkAccessToken) {
const accessTokenExpired =
oauthAccessTokenExpiration.getTime() < UTCNowTimestamp
if (!accessTokenExpired) {
return oauthAccessToken
}
}
const refreshTokenExpired =
oauthRefreshTokenExpiration.getTime() < UTCNowTimestamp
if (refreshTokenExpired) {
const updatedUser = await getUser(userId)
subscriptionManager.publish(USER_UPDATED, {
userUpdated: updatedUser,
})
// logger.error(
// `refresh token for provider ${providerLabel} expired, authorization flow should (provider login) be followed by the user`,
// )
// return false
throw new Error(
`refresh token for provider ${providerLabel} expired, authorization flow should (provider login) be followed by the user`,
)
}
const integrations = config.has('integrations') && config.get('integrations')
if (!integrations) {
throw new Error('Integrations are undefined in config')
}
const externalProvider = integrations[providerLabel]
if (!externalProvider) {
throw new Error(`Integration ${providerLabel} configuration is undefined `)
}
const { tokenUrl, clientId } = integrations[providerLabel]
if (!tokenUrl) {
throw new Error(`Integration ${providerLabel} tokenUrl is undefined `)
}
if (!clientId) {
throw new Error(`Integration ${providerLabel} clientId is undefined `)
}
const tokenData = new URLSearchParams({
grant_type: 'refresh_token',
refresh_token: oauthRefreshToken,
client_id: clientId,
})
const { data, status } = await axios({
method: 'post',
url: tokenUrl,
headers: { 'Content-Type': 'application/x-www-form-urlencoded' },
data: tokenData.toString(),
})
if (status === 401) {
// for the case that something happened and refreshToken become invalid -> set that expired
await invalidateProviderTokens(userId, providerLabel)
}
/* eslint-disable camelcase */
const { access_token, expires_in, refresh_token, refresh_expires_in } = data
if (!access_token) {
throw new Error('Missing access_token from response!')
}
if (envUtils.isValidPositiveIntegerOrZero(expires_in)) {
throw new Error('Missing expires_in from response!')
}
if (!refresh_token) {
throw new Error('Missing refresh_token from response!')
}
if (envUtils.isValidPositiveIntegerOrZero(refresh_expires_in)) {
throw new Error('Missing refresh_expires_in from response!')
}
await Identity.patchAndFetchById(providerUserIdentity.id, {
oauthAccessToken: access_token,
oauthRefreshToken: refresh_token,
oauthAccessTokenExpiration:
expires_in === 0 ? foreverDate : getExpirationTime(expires_in),
oauthRefreshTokenExpiration:
refresh_expires_in === 0
? foreverDate
: getExpirationTime(refresh_expires_in),
})
if (returnAccessToken) {
return access_token
}
return true
}
const renewAuthTokens = async (userId, providerLabel) =>
requestTokensFromProvider(userId, providerLabel, { checkAccessToken: false })
